This PR reworks the pagination engine in InkLedger's PDF invoice renderer. Previously, line items that overflowed a page were silently clipped; now we measure each row's rendered height before committing it, and carry overflow rows to a continuation page with a repeated header. I've also extracted the layout magic numbers into a single constants module so they're discoverable — new folks kept asking where the margins lived. For context while reviewing, the current layout and pagination constants are shown here.

constants for bawif-kawif:
QUOTAS = {
    "ulaael": 5,
    "holael": 10,
}

## Break-glass access: Formula Sandbox (Quillgrid)

If user-supplied formulas wedge the sandbox evaluator and the kill-switch API is unreachable, you can break glass and attach directly to the sandbox host. Don't do this for routine debugging — it bypasses the audit proxy, so file a note afterward. To unseal the emergency console, enter the passphrase below.

vault phrase of taweg-kafof = oliax-zorael

## Deployment — Quillgraph N+1 fix

This release replaces per-field resolver fetches with a batched dataloader layer in Quillgraph, eliminating the N+1 query pattern on the orders and members types. Release manager: deploy to staging first and compare query counts against the baseline dashboard; expect roughly a 40x drop on list-heavy pages. Rollback is a standard image pin; no schema changes ship with this build. The loader reads its runtime configuration at boot, with the current values given below.

settings of taguf-fajef:
[eliath]
team = julir
access_code = ac_78465c
host = eliath.lumicgrid.local
port = 8443
owner = feniel.wenir
peer = quenmir.tolvaqsys.local